概括
我们介绍了普通盒子 (Buxus sempervirens) 的基因组组合,这是植物基因组学的重大进展. 这种高质量的组件为了解木遗传学和进化提供了基础资源.
科学领域:
- 植物基因组学 植物基因组学
- 分子生物学分子生物学
- 进化生物学 进化生物学
背景情况:
- 常常 (Buxus sempervirens) 是一个生态和经济上重要的植物物种.
- 高质量的基因组组合对于理解植物遗传学,进化和育种至关重要.
研究的目的:
- 为了生成和呈现一个高品质的基因组组合,为 *Buxus sempervirens*.
- 提供一个基本的基因组资源Buxaceae家族.
主要方法:
- 一个单个 *Buxus sempervirens* 标本的全基因组测序.
- 基因组序列的生物信息组装和支架.
- 塑体和线粒体基因组的组合.
主要成果:
- 总基因组序列长度达到了676.70兆基.
- 99.56%的组件成功地被支架成14种染色体伪分子.
- 塑基因组组装为150.93千基基,以及8个线粒体序列.
结论:
- 提出的基因组组合代表了 *Buxus sempervirens * 研究的重要里程碑.
- 这一资源将促进植物遗传学,比较基因组学和木物种保护方面的未来研究.

Maxam-Gilbert Sequencing
13.5K
In the same year as the discovery of the Sanger sequencing method, another group of scientists, Allan Maxam and Walter Gilbert, demonstrated their chemical-cleavage method for DNA sequencing. The Maxam-Gilbert method relies on using different chemicals that can cleave the DNA sequence at specific sites, the separation of resulting DNA fragments of variable size using electrophoresis, and deciphering the DNA sequence from the resulting gel bands.

Cis-regulatory Sequences
12.1K
Cis-regulatory sequences are short fragments of non-coding DNA that are present on the same chromosomes as the genes that they regulate. These fragments serve as binding sites for transcriptional regulators, proteins that are responsible for controlling gene transcription and differential gene expression across cell types in eukaryotes.
